    Barney Mac Laughlin, Meenolin, Glentogher, aged seventy-six years was also a famous runner. The both of themran races in all parts of Donegal and they came in first in all.
    Tomas Mac Laughlin, Cashel, Glentogher, who lived to about seventy and died sixteen years ago was a very strong man. He was a good jumper. He could throw two fifty sixes four yards. He could jump six feet high. He could jump a river eight feet broad.
